SMTK  @SMTK_VERSION@
Simulation Modeling Tool Kit
smtk::view::SubphraseGenerator Member List

This is the complete list of members for smtk::view::SubphraseGenerator, including all inherited members.

addComponentPhrases(const T &components, DescriptivePhrase::Ptr parent, DescriptivePhrases &result, int mutability=static_cast< int >(smtk::view::PhraseContent::ContentType::TITLE)|static_cast< int >(smtk::view::PhraseContent::ContentType::COLOR), std::function< bool(const DescriptivePhrase::Ptr &, const DescriptivePhrase::Ptr &)> comparator=DescriptivePhrase::compareByTypeThenTitle)smtk::view::SubphraseGeneratorprotected
addModelEntityPhrases(const T &ents, DescriptivePhrase::Ptr parent, int limit, DescriptivePhrases &result, int mutability=static_cast< int >(smtk::view::PhraseContent::ContentType::TITLE)|static_cast< int >(smtk::view::PhraseContent::ContentType::COLOR), std::function< bool(const DescriptivePhrase::Ptr &, const DescriptivePhrase::Ptr &)> comparator=nullptr)smtk::view::SubphraseGeneratorprotected
boundingCellsOfModelCell(DescriptivePhrase::Ptr src, const smtk::model::CellE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
boundingShellsOfModelUse(DescriptivePhrase::Ptr src, const smtk::model::UseE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
cellOfModelUse(DescriptivePhrase::Ptr src, const smtk::model::UseE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
childrenOfModelAuxiliaryGeometry(DescriptivePhrase::Ptr src, const smtk::model::AuxiliaryGeometry &aux,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
childrenOfModelEntity(DescriptivePhrase::Ptr src, smtk::model::EntityPtr modelEntity,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
componentsOfResource(DescriptivePhrase::Ptr src, smtk::resource::ResourcePtr rsrc,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
create(const std::string &typeName, const smtk::view::ManagerPtr &manager) (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orstatic
createSubPhrase(const smtk::resource::PersistentObjectPtr &obj, const DescriptivePhrasePtr &parent, Path &childPath)smtk::view::SubphraseGeneratorvirtual
directLimit() constsmtk::view::SubphraseGeneratorvirtual
filterModelEntityPhraseCandidates(T &ents)smtk::view::SubphraseGeneratorprotected
findResourceLocation(smtk::resource::ResourcePtr rsrc, const DescriptivePhrase::Ptr &root) const (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otectedvirtual
findSortedLocation(Path &pathOut, smtk::attribute::AttributePtr attr, DescriptivePhrase::Ptr &phr, const DescriptivePhrase::Ptr &parent) const (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otectedvirtual
findSortedLocation(Path &pathOut, smtk::model::EntityPtr entity, DescriptivePhrase::Ptr &phr, const DescriptivePhrase::Ptr &parent) const (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otectedvirtual
findSortedLocation(Path &pathOut, smtk::mesh::ComponentPtr comp, DescriptivePhrase::Ptr &phr, const DescriptivePhrase::Ptr &parent) const (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otectedvirtual
freeAuxiliaryGeometriesOfModel(DescriptivePhrase::Ptr src, const smtk::model::Model &mod,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
freeCellsOfModel(DescriptivePhrase::Ptr src, const smtk::model::Model &mod,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
freeGroupsOfModel(DescriptivePhrase::Ptr src, const smtk::model::Model &mod,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
freeSubmodelsOfModel(DescriptivePhrase::Ptr src, const smtk::model::Model &mod,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
getType(const smtk::view::ConfigurationPtr &viewSpec) (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orstatic
hasChildren(const DescriptivePhrase &src) constsmtk::view::SubphraseGeneratorvirtual
inclusionsOfModelCell(DescriptivePhrase::Ptr src, const smtk::model::CellE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
IndexFromTitle(const std::string &title, const T &phrases)smtk::view::SubphraseGeneratorprotected
indexOfObjectInParent(const smtk::resource::PersistentObjectPtr &obj, const smtk::view::DescriptivePhrasePtr &parent, const Path &parentPath) (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otectedvirtual
instancesOfModelEntity(DescriptivePhrase::Ptr src, const smtk::model::EntityRef &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
itemsOfAttribute(DescriptivePhrase::Ptr src, smtk::attribute::AttributePtr att,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
m_directLimit (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otected
m_manager (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otected
m_model (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otected
m_skipAttributes (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otected
m_skipProperties (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orprotected
Manager (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
manager() constsmtk::view::SubphraseGeneratorinline
membersOfModelGroup(DescriptivePhrase::Ptr src, const smtk::model::Group &grp,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
model() constsmtk::view::SubphraseGeneratorinline
modelEntityHasChildren(const smtk::model::EntityPtr &entity) constsmtk::view::SubphraseGeneratorprotected
parentObjects(const smtk::resource::PersistentObjectPtr &obj) constsmtk::view::SubphraseGeneratorvirtual
Path typedef (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
PhrasesByPath typedef (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
PreparePath(T &result, const T &parentPath, int childIndex)smtk::view::SubphraseGeneratorprotected
prototypeOfModelInstance(DescriptivePhrase::Ptr src, const smtk::model::Instance &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
resourceHasChildren(const smtk::resource::ResourcePtr &rsrc) constsmtk::view::SubphraseGeneratorprotected
setDirectLimit(int val)smtk::view::SubphraseGeneratorvirtual
setModel(PhraseModelPtr model)smtk::view::SubphraseGenerator
setSkipAttributes(bool val)smtk::view::SubphraseGeneratorvirtual
setSkipProperties(bool val)smtk::view::SubphraseGeneratorvirtual
shouldOmitProperty(DescriptivePhrase::Ptr parent, smtk::resource::PropertyType ptype, const std::string &pname) constsmtk::view::SubphraseGeneratorvirtual
skipAttributes() constsmtk::view::SubphraseGeneratorvirtual
skipProperties() constsmtk::view::SubphraseGeneratorvirtual
smtkCreateMacro(smtk::view::SubphraseGenerator) (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
smtkTypeMacroBase(smtk::view::SubphraseGenerator) (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
SubphraseGenerator() (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Generator
subphrases(DescriptivePhrase::Ptr src)smtk::view::SubphraseGeneratorvirtual
subphrasesForCreatedObjects(const smtk::resource::PersistentObjectArray &objects, const DescriptivePhrasePtr &localRoot, PhrasesByPath &resultingPhrases)smtk::view::SubphraseGeneratorvirtual
toplevelShellsOfModelUse(DescriptivePhrase::Ptr src, const smtk::model::UseE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
usesOfModelCell(DescriptivePhrase::Ptr src, const smtk::model::CellE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
usesOfModelShell(DescriptivePhrase::Ptr src, const smtk::model::ShellEntity &ent, DescriptivePhrases &result)smtk::view::SubphraseGeneratorprotected
~SubphraseGenerator()=default (defined in smtk::view::SubphraseGenerator)smtk::view::SubphraseGeneratorvirtual